254. An Antique Britannia Musical Box

An antique Britannia musical box, measuring approx. 21-3/8"H x 16-1/2"W x 9-1/2"D. The case is in the form of a two-door table top cabinet with a plinth base set up on small turned legs, pretty inlaid wood doors and a pierced panel above with a scrolling design, with the top a simple crown molding. The case is made from a rich brown wood with parts of the base and the crown painted black, as is the interior. The inlay on the doors is in the form of edge banding around a panel of a different exotic wood. There are classical-motif and heraldic transfer images on each panel in polychrome with gilt, and there are two silver-tone metal key escutcheons, one with a working locking mechanism and it's key on the right side door. In the interior below the workings are encased in the lower portion with a glass front that unscrews. The disc player has a pretty lyre-shaped detail and behind the disc is "The Britannia" on a cast brass plaque. The musical box comes with nine 9" discs. There is a crank handle at the right side of the case and a brake lever.



1,500/2,500   Sold $1,782.50
